Dianella tasmanica 'Variegata' (White Striped Tasman Flax Lily) - A beautiful strap-leafed perennial with clumps to 18 to 24 inches tall bearing fans of rich green leaves with bold white longitudinal stripes and a finely serrated leaf margin. Dianella tasmanica, also known as Tasman flax lily or simply flax lily, is a sedge-like, rhizomatous, herbaceous perennial native to Tasmania and southeastern Australia.Its narrow, strap-like leaves can reach 3' long, and individual plants can reach 1.5-2' tall. The University of Florida IFAS Extension recommends the use of controlled-release fertilizers with equal amounts of potassium and nitrogen and little to no phosphorous content for perennials such as flax lilies.
